5  TS3/TSM: The Pudding / The World Of Pudding / Lighting and Shadows issue - lots are covered in shadows on: 2010 January 28, 22:36:19
All of the lots in my game, regardless of where they are located or whether they are empty or populated, are covered in shadows, almost like overcast on a cloudy day (but in broad game daylight) or something huge hovering above. The rooftops of all lots in the area (and any high ground such as hills) will briefly flash as if the game is attempting to render normal daylight but can't fully.  Normal shadows, such as from trees and buildings, work fine, but I am having entire lots darkened out by shadows that have no discernible source.  Examples:

Empty lot in Build/Buy Mode:





Same area in live mode:



Another set of lots in shadow (all should be visible in full daylight like the house on the far left)



I have the base game only and am updated to patch 1.8.  This problem didn't start until I updated to that patch, and I never had the issue prior to that.  If I turn the Lighting and Shadows setting to LOW, the problem seems to go away for a while, but prior to patch 1.8 I was able to have that setting on HIGH with no problems whatsoever (my card is an GeForce 8800GTS).  I have the latest AwesomeMod installed and a few other non-core mods (no lighting mods), plus a great deal of custom content.  I have Google searched this issue extensively and posted on the TS3 forum with no solution found.

As far as actions I have taken so far, I have:

  • updated my Nvidia drivers to the latest (196.21)
  • taken out ALL of my cc, mods, & hacks
  • adjusted the Lighting & Shadows setting to low (it had been on high with NO PROBLEMS before the patch - setting it to low seems to get rid of the issue, but it shouldn't have to be on low)
  • tested it in live mode and build/buy mode in different hoods and with different saves
  • tested it in all saved games in Sunset Valley and Riverview (the problem persists in both)
  • tested several combinations of graphics settings in-game in fullscreen and windowed mode

I'm at my wits end here.  I've been having a Flagrant System Error with AwesomeMod in one neighborhood...could that be related?  I'm hoping to find a solution to this without having to reinstall (which is the only option I haven't tried as it's my last resort).

Has anyone else experienced this, or does anyone know of a fix?
